“A whole bookshelf of the immortals”—that was what publisher J. M. Dent aimed to make available and affordableto every reader when he founded the Everyman’s Library in 1906.

While Everyman’s Library has continued to realize Dent’sambition more than one hundred years later—publishing every-thing from Aeschylus to Atwood—we are particularly proud ofthe line of Contemporary Classics that we began in 1995.

The Contemporary Classics series represents, quite simply,the best literature of our times, in beautifully packaged hardcov-ers meant to stand the test of time. These are works from the pastcentury that have achieved the status of modern classics, and thewriters form an all-star lineup that few publishers can match.They range from such icons as James Joyce and Virginia Woolf toliving legends like Toni Morrison, John Updike, Salman Rushdie,and Margaret Atwood, and to giants of international literature aswell, from Gabriel García Márquez to Naguib Mahfouz.

J. M. Dent wanted to appeal to “every kind of reader,” and inthat tradition we offer every kind of classic, from the lightheartedwit of P. G. Wodehouse to the dark humor of Roald Dahl, fromnoir classics by Dashiell Hammett and Raymond Chandler to non-fiction masterpieces such as the essays of Albert Camus andGeorge Orwell.

Our editions are often the only hardcover edition available.We offer many unique omnibus collections, such as John Updike’sRabbit novels, a selection of Alice Munro’s own favorite storiesfrom across her career, and the only single-volume, illustrated edition of the collected works of Kahlil Gibran.

We hope they will help you fill your own bookshelves witha permanent library of the immortals of our own time.

LuAnn WaltherEditorial Director, Everyman’s Library

U = Universal (type only color jacket) I = Illustrated (color jacket with an illustration/image) A NOTE ON THE COLORED CLOTH BINDING: Each Everyman’s Library book has a colored cloth binding denoting the period of the work: Scarlet = Contemporary Classics Navy = 20th Century Burgundy = Victorian Literature/19th Century Dark Green = Pre-Victorian/Romantic/18th Century Light Blue = 17th Century and Earlier Celadon Green = Non-Western Classics Mauve = Ancient Classics Sand = Poetry A NOTE ON SETS: Selections from the Everyman’s Library, including our three series, are available for purchase as multi-volume sets. Everyman’s Library continues to maintain its originalcommitment to publishing the most significant worldliterature in editions that reflect a tradition of finebookmaking. Everyman’s Library pursues the highest standards, utilizing modern prepress, printing, andbinding technologies to produce classically designedbooks printed on acid-free cream-colored paper andincluding Smyth-sewn signatures, full-cloth cases withtwo-color stamping, decorative endpapers, silk ribbonmarkers, and European-style half-round spines. EachEveryman’s Library book has a colored cloth case denoting the historical period of the work.

In 1905, Joseph Dent resolved to publish a library ofworld literature that would appeal to “every kind ofreader: the worker, the student, the cultured man,

the child, the man and the woman.” He envisioned abalanced selection of classics and other worthy books,from the popular to the specialized, that would combineto create the perfect library so that “a man may be intel-lectually rich for life.”

In 1991, Everyman’s Library was relaunched with thesupport of Alfred A. Knopf in the United States. Therevived library featured a fine, easy-to-read typographicdesign, sewn cloth bindings, acid-free paper, silk ribbon-markers, and substantial new introductions andchronologies by leading scholars and writers. Pride andPrejudice was the first of 50 titles to be published inSeptember 1991, and within twelve months 130 titleshad appeared, including such major twentieth-centuryclassics as Joyce’s Ulysses, Kafka’s The Trial, andPasternak’s Doctor Zhivago, none of which had previouslybeen published in Everyman’s Library.

By the 100th Anniversary in 2006 the list of Everyman’sLibrary authors included Chinua Achebe, Isabel Allende,Penelope Fitzgerald, Patricia Highsmith, CormacMcCarthy, Toni Morrison, Vladimir Nabokov, SalmanRushdie, John Updike, and Evelyn Waugh. AndEveryman’s Library continues to grow today, fulfillingDent’s wish by creating a catalog that few publishers canrival in paperback and of course none in hardcover.
